Unchain My EL Reasoner
Yevgeny Kazakov‚ Markus Krötzsch and Frantisek Simancik
Abstract
We study a restriction of the classification procedure for EL++ where the inference rule for complex role inclusion axioms (RIAs) is applied in a ``left-linear'' way in analogy with the well-known procedure for computing the transitive closure of a binary relation. We introduce a notion of left-admissibility for a set of RIAs, which specifies when a subset of RIAs can be used in a left-linear way without loosing consequences, prove a criterion which can be used to effectively check this property, and describe some preliminary experimental results analyzing when the restricted procedure can give practical improvements.
